1 # SPDX-License-Identifier: GPL-2.0-only OR BSD-2-Clause
2 %YAML 1.2
3 ---
4 $id: http://devicetree.org/schemas/display/msm/qcom,msm8998-mdss.yaml#
5 $schema: http://devicetree.org/meta-schemas/core.yaml#
6
7 title: Qualcomm MSM8998 Display MDSS
8
9 maintainers:
10   - AngeloGioacchino Del Regno <angelogioacchino.delregno@somainline.org>
11
12 description:
13   Device tree bindings for MSM Mobile Display Subsystem(MDSS) that encapsulates
14   sub-blocks like DPU display controller, DSI and DP interfaces etc. Device tree
15   bindings of MDSS are mentioned for MSM8998 target.
16
17 $ref: /schemas/display/msm/mdss-common.yaml#
18
19 properties:
20   compatible:
21     const: qcom,msm8998-mdss
22
23   clocks:
24     items:
25       - description: Display AHB clock
26       - description: Display AXI clock
27       - description: Display core clock
28
29   clock-names:
30     items:
31       - const: iface
32       - const: bus
33       - const: core
34
35   iommus:
36     maxItems: 1
37
38 patternProperties:
39   "^display-controller@[0-9a-f]+$":
40     type: object
41     additionalProperties: true
42
43     properties:
44       compatible:
45         const: qcom,msm8998-dpu
46
47   "^dsi@[0-9a-f]+$":
48     type: object
49     additionalProperties: true
50
51     properties:
52       compatible:
53         items:
54           - const: qcom,msm8998-dsi-ctrl
55           - const: qcom,mdss-dsi-ctrl
56
57   "^phy@[0-9a-f]+$":
58     type: object
59     additionalProperties: true
60
61     properties:
62       compatible:
63         const: qcom,dsi-phy-10nm-8998
64
65 required:
66   - compatible
67
68 unevaluatedProperties: false
